G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Deaktivieren Sie das Feedback bei der Eingabe des Passworts an einer sudo-Eingabeaufforderung

Ich habe dies in einem anderen Thread gefunden und es stellt sicher, dass, wenn die Mint-Entwickler dieses schlechte Feature in einem neuen Update wieder einführen, Ihre eigenen Änderungen es außer Kraft setzen:

Die akzeptierte Antwort, einfach /etc/sudoers.d/0pwfeedback zu entfernen wird genau funktionieren, bis das nächste Update von mintsystem diese Datei wieder an Ort und Stelle bringt.

Der Weg, um zum alten Verhalten zurückzukehren, das von der für das neue verantwortlichen Person empfohlen wird, besteht darin, die Einstellung in einer anderen Datei zu überschreiben, die später gelesen wird:

echo 'Defaults !pwfeedback'|sudo tee /etc/sudoers.d/9_no_pwfeedback

Quelle:https://unix.stackexchange.com/questions/491173/linux-mint-how-to-set-the-terminal-password-to-be-invisible


Nach einigen weiteren Recherchen zu Dateien in /etc/sudoers.d Verzeichnis habe ich hier die richtige Antwort gefunden:

LinuxMint. Wie kann ich das Terminal-Passwort unsichtbar machen?

Es heißt:

LinuxMint hat das Verhalten in /etc/sudoers.d/0pwfeedback hinzugefügt .
Sie könnten einfach so vorgehen wie ich – die Datei löschen, da sie nur diese Anpassung enthält:

sudo rm -rf /etc/sudoers.d/0pwfeedback

Laut @SyntaxxxErr0r funktioniert auch das Umbenennen der Datei:wenn sie auf ~ endet oder enthält einen . Zeichen, es wird nicht geparst.

Kürzlich hat @elsewhere eine andere Lösung vorgeschlagen, die zukunftssicherer und stabiler über Paketaktualisierungen hinweg ist, und deshalb wähle ich diese Antwort als die hilfreichste aus.


Linux
  1. Defekte Sudoers-Datei reparieren – sudo:Analysefehler in /etc/sudoers in der Nähe von Zeile 21 [Ubuntu]

  2. Wie behandelt Linux mehrere aufeinanderfolgende Pfadtrennzeichen (/home////username///file)?

  3. Linux – Sudo kann /etc/sudoers nicht öffnen?

  4. Fügen Sie einen Sudoer nicht interaktiv von der Befehlszeile aus hinzu

  5. Warum benötigt root das Passwort nicht, um sudo auszuführen, selbst wenn NOPASSWD:ALL nicht in /etc/sudoers geschrieben ist

Lassen Sie sich von Sudo beleidigen, wenn Sie ein falsches Passwort eingeben

Verstehen der /etc/shadow-Datei

Fehler in Sudoers-Datei? So können Sie es beheben.

Sudo fragt nicht mehr nach dem Passwort?

Die Dateien /proc/mounts, /etc/mtab und /proc/partitions verstehen

Ich habe meine /etc/sudoers-Datei auf Amazon EC2 beschädigt